Vitalik Buterin Clarifies Leadership Decision Process for Ethereum Foundation

According to Vitalik Buterin, the decision-making process for appointing the new Ethereum Foundation leadership team rests solely with him until a formal board is established. This statement clarifies the ongoing reforms within the Ethereum Foundation, which may affect Ethereum's stability and investor confidence, impacting trading decisions (source: @VitalikButerin).
SourceAnalysis
On January 21, 2025, at 14:30 UTC, Ethereum co-founder Vitalik Buterin made a significant announcement regarding the leadership of the Ethereum Foundation (EF) via Twitter. He stated, "No. This is not how this game works. The person deciding the new EF leadership team is me. One of the goals of the ongoing reform is to give the EF a 'proper board', but until that happens it's me" (VitalikButerin, Twitter, January 21, 2025).
